1

NSPredicate (またはその他の方法) を使用して、子オブジェクトとその親を検索できるかどうか、およびその方法を理解するのに苦労しています。たとえば、名前、ブドウ園、地域、年などのプロパティを持つワイン オブジェクトがあります。次に、WhoSharedWith、FoodAteWith、EventDate などのプロパティを持つ "Event" のような子オブジェクトがあります。Wine オブジェクトの述語を理解できますが、人が "Steak" と入力した場合はどうなるでしょうか。ワインオブジェクトの下の「イベント」オブジェクトを検索して、どのワインがステーキに適しているかを確認したいと考えています。誰でも私を助けることができますか?

ありがとう

4

1 に答える 1

0

コア データの用語では、関係によって接続された複数のエンティティ (イベント、ワイン) があります。親エンティティと子エンティティの概念はありません (実行していないように見えるサブクラス化に似たサブエンティティを作成している場合を除きます)。

すべてのエンティティはピアです。オブジェクト グラフのどこからでも開始でき、関係をたどって関連オブジェクトに到達できます。関係のキーパスを述語で使用できます。述語プログラミング ガイドを参照してください。

于 2013-03-28T19:55:49.663 に答える